Hackney Wick train station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a comfortable experience, although it might lack some of the niceties you'd find in larger stations. For buying tickets, you can make use of the ticket machines and collect pre-purchased tickets from there as well. However, traditional ticket office services are limited to weekday mornings (from 07:30 to 10:00). The station's notable focus on accessibility includes step-free access throughout, accessible ticket machines, and a range of facilities tailored to assist those needing additional support.
The station is aimed at being inclusive for all travelers. While there are no ordinary toilets, you will find accessible toilets available, making it easier for everyone to navigate through journeys without unnecessary hassle. Additionally, waiting rooms are open Monday to Friday from 07:00 to 13:00, but note there isn't continuous staff assistance throughout the week.
Getting around from Hackney Wick is straightforward thanks to its decent local transport connections. For those times when rail services are interrupted, bus stops in Hepscott Road offer rail replacement services, ensuring you can still make your way east towards Stratford or west towards Camden Road, Hampstead Heath, and Richmond. It should be noted that while cycling is encouraged, with storage for up to six bicycles monitored by CCTV, there are no cycle hire facilities at the station.

Accrington station is equipped for a convenient ticket-buying experience. The ticket office is open from 06:40 to 15:00 on Mondays and 09:10 to 16:45 on Sundays. You can also purchase tickets via machines, which are accessible on Platform 2 near the footbridge, and collect online bookings conveniently. Although there are no smartcard validators, smartcards can be issued at the station.
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access in parts of the station. Platform 1 offers a steep 50m ramp alongside handrails for added security, and Platform 2 features a gently sloping footpath. The station is categorized as a Scooter Friendly Station. Despite the lack of waiting rooms and accessible toilets, seating areas and a community-run café open during the morning ensure comfort while waiting for your train. There's no CCTV in the bicycle storage area, but it provides sheltered spaces within the station, offering secure storage for up to 32 bicycles.
Accrington station is well-connected with various transport options. If you find yourself needing a rail replacement service, head to Eagle Street next to the entrance of the station's car park. For taxi services, the spot is conveniently located at the bottom of the ramp outside the station. While bus services can be planned with printable information, bicycle hire is not available at this location. Make sure to plan accordingly if you intend to use a bike for onward travel.
